Why You Should Hire a Truck Accident Lawyer

Truck accidents are different from car crashes because the victims can suffer devastating injuries. These injuries are generally permanent, and require extensive medical treatment.

Both the federal and state governments regulate trucks. This means that they need to adhere to strict rules. A semi truck accident attorney truck accident lawyer knows these rules in detail.

Experience

Commercial truck accidents can result in severe injuries that require expensive medical treatment and long-term care. Financial hardships are also common among victims. These expenses can quickly drain savings and lead to massive debt, causing serious stress. A semi truck accident lawyer can assist you in recovering financially.

An experienced lawyer can negotiate a much larger settlement for you than what the insurance company initially offers. They will know how much you'll need to pay for medical bills and loss of income as well as other costs arising from the accident. They will also know how to best present your case, and also show the damage caused by the accident.

A reputable lawyer for truck accidents will have extensive experience negotiating with big insurance companies and large commercial transport firms that own or hire the trucks. They will know the particulars of this highly-regulated industry and how to negotiate with these intimidating companies. They can quickly identify the responsible parties and request crucial documentation to build a strong argument for compensation.

For instance, they will examine the black-box information of the truck to determine the reason for the accident. They will also request the maintenance logs to determine if the truck has been inspected and serviced in accordance with the regulations. These documents may be difficult to obtain as trucking companies aren't likely to share the documents in a voluntary manner. A seasoned truck accident lawyer can help you get these documents by requesting an order from the court to keep them.

A second factor to consider is whether the load is properly secured or balanced. Uneven distribution of weight may cause the jackknife of the truck to occur or it could shift and hit other vehicles. This is especially risky if the truck is carrying dangerous materials, like explosives or chemicals. A semi truck accident lawyer with knowledge of the law will know what to look out for and how to conduct an investigation. They will be able to determine whether the trucking firm or the owner of the truck was negligent when loading or unloading the cargo.

Truck accidents are more complex than a car accident involving two vehicles. Truck accidents can involve multiple parties which include the driver (who may be an independent contractor) along with the trucking company and even the shipping company of the goods being hauled. Additionally states have their own laws regarding the amount of liability a plaintiff must bear in order to receive damages.

Because of these complexities trucking companies employ lawyers and experts on retainer in order to safeguard their interests. Consequently, they are less likely to accept a settlement for the entire amount of your losses. If you take the initiative you could find yourself bullied by the insurer into accepting a lower-ball offer. You can ward off these tactics by choosing the right truck accident lawyer.

Your lawyer will be able to evaluate your injuries and determine the amount of compensation you're entitled to. They will also be capable of documenting your injuries and work with insurance companies in order to obtain an appropriate settlement. In addition, they'll know when to file a lawsuit to make the at-fault party accountable for the loss you suffered.

A reputable truck accident attorney will thoroughly investigate your crash to determine who is accountable. This will involve a variety of steps, from looking over the scene of the accident, to interviewing eyewitnesses. It could also involve obtaining data from the truck's "black box." This data could be vital in proving your case. The trucking company may not want to give this information to you, but a seasoned lawyer may file a lawsuit and request that the black box be kept for inspection.

Punitive damages

If you submit a personal injury claim in order to seek compensation for losses that you have suffered as a result of defendant's negligence or inattention to safety. The compensation you receive could be used to pay for medical bills, loss of income due to time off work and property damage. The money you receive can also be used to pay for future losses, like physical therapy or ongoing treatments. Other damages, like pain and suffering are more difficult to quantify but still deserve fair compensation.

In addition to the monetary damages, there could be cases where the at-fault party is ordered to pay punitive damages. These are designed to punish the defendant for their unprofessional conduct, such as reckless driving or speeding which led to the accident. They can also be awarded if the company has demonstrated a reckless disregard for safety regulations and the basic maintenance procedures.

An experienced and qualified truck accident lawyer can help you determine if there is a valid reason for pursuing punitive damages which are typically reserved for cases where the defendant's actions were especially outrageous. If the driver was taking stimulants to stay awake and caused an accident, a jury may give punitive damages.

If someone close to your heart suffered a fatal crash, you may have the right to claim compensation for the wrongful death of the people responsible. These damages can include funeral costs, loss of companionship and support, as well as suffering and pain prior to the death.

Trial skills

A truck accident lawyer should be comfortable taking a case through to trial. This includes depositions, legal documents, and other court procedures which require excellent communication skills as well as research and time management. The most skilled semi truck accident lawyers will be well-versed in all the steps of a lawsuit and have prior experience representing clients in court.

A semi truck accident lawyer who is proficient will be able to negotiate with insurance companies and the other parties involved. They should be able to take responsibility for the entire cost of the victim and negotiate an agreement that covers these costs.

The injuries resulting from accidents involving trucks can be catastrophic. They can result in serious and permanent injuries, making victims unable to work and with life-altering disabilities. A semi truck accident lawyer who is skilled will be able to comprehend the consequences of these accidents on their clients' lives and fight for their rights.

While the most common truck accident causes involve driver errors, such as distracted driving, fatigued, speeding or improperly loading cargo, other factors can contribute to an accident. Weather conditions, trucking errors like forcing drivers to work with insufficient rest, and defective parts are all possible causes. A skilled lawyer can review the evidence and determine those who may be responsible for the crash.

A reputable semi-truck accident lawyer should also be able secure the black box information from the truck. These devices can provide valuable data about what occurred at the time of accident including the speed at which the truck was traveling at. This information is crucial to determining the root of the accident. Trucking companies and their insurers don't usually want to share this information with their customers however an experienced attorney will be able to secure an order from the court to access the information.

It is crucial to engage a lawyer with experience as early as you can after the accident. This will give them the time to examine all the evidence and create a convincing legal argument on your behalf.
